Tips For Responding To Financial Instability In 2017

Most of us would agree that America has suffered from a pretty unstable financial market over the past few years and so far 2017 seems to be following suit. In a study undertaken by The Fund For Peace, a global index measuring national security and economic stability, the U.S. was ranked the 13th most worsened nation last year.
